Art Feast at Artspace in Crestwood Court

— Feed your tummy while enjoying demonstrations of the creative arts on Saturday, October 22, 2011 at ArtSpace in Crestwood Court (formerly Crestwood Plaza) at the 1st Art Feast.

A bevy of St. Louis’s favorite food trucks will be on hand to provide an array of outstanding culinary delights, including trucks from Papa Tom's, Gateway Dog House, Sicily Street, Shell's Coastal Cuisine, Cha Cha Chow, Seoul Taco, Sarah's Cake Stop, Wanderlust Pizza, The Sweet Divine, and Speedway Eatery.

In addition to outstanding food, the works of performing and visual artists of ArtSpace in Crestwood Court will be on display. Ensuring an afternoon with something for everyone, there will be a Pumpkin Carving Contest sponsored by the Crestwood Department of Parks and Recreation.

The festival is being held in the Mall parking lot on Watson Road near the Sears entrance, with plenty of free parking. Crestwood Court is located on Watson Road just east of Sappington Road, about 3 miles east of Highway 270. The event will begin at 11a.m. and end at 6p.m. There is no admission charge.
